You will submit your draw request form with all supporting documents such as invoices and/or receipts to draws@easystreetcap.com.

Easy Street Capital will send a third party inspector to the property to document the improvements that have been noted on the draw request form.

If we are given all of the information we need upfront, we can quickly order the inspection and have your money to you within 3 - 5 business days after you send us your draw request.

You are allowed to take as many draws as necessary but we would like to remind you there is a draw fee for each one to cover inspection costs.

The draw request form is part of the scope of work completed prior to closing. Additional supporting documents can be found here: https://hubs.ly/H0pt5b10

1. Filled out and signed copy of the Conditional Waiver and Release on Progress Payment. 2. Filled out Scope of Work and Draw Request Form for the items being requested in this draw. Please provide lockbox code or access instructions as well. 3. Receipts and invoices for the items being requested in the draw that equals or exceeds the draw amount being requested.
